Transaction 045821ee68f264f1b17d864269302544fbf8b334ec66f70cdb28307694bf2e48

1 Input
2 Outputs
  • 045821ee68f264f1b17d864269302544fbf8b334ec66f70cdb28307694bf2e48:0
  • value  21805
    address  3P81YR31z2W1vgtu1Qx1MtcJartroY3usm
  • 045821ee68f264f1b17d864269302544fbf8b334ec66f70cdb28307694bf2e48:1
  • value  1162600
    address  3Kg88s5g442m2ebR4nfSiwnpKJXS4Xgfrp